DocNomads films presented in BEAST, Portugal
The 6th BEAST - International Film Festival, with focus in films from the Central and Eastern Europe, presents a special program with the showcase DOCNOMADS – Short Stories, and three more films from graduated students selected to the Official Competition / East Doc section, Budapest Silo, A Hand And A Half, The Silence of the Banana Trees.
BEAST will be held between 27 September and 1 October in the city of Oporto.
BEAST presents the showcase DOCNOMADS – Short Stories aiming to highlight documentary cinema’s profound potential as a storytelling medium and a bridge between cultures, also with the objective of amplifying the innovative works of a new generation and rising filmmakers.
This special program showcases the documentaries Dusk by Bálint Bíró, All Our Nights by Nicole Reale, Viv Li, Zsófia Paczolay, May the Earth Become the Sky by Ana Vîjdea, My Uncle Tudor by Olga Lucovnicova.
